The Maslauskiškiai Water Mill was built in 1895, constructed from bricks and stones. It belonged to the manor that once stood here. The mill was damaged during World War II but was later rebuilt. Currently, it is a private property, and visits are only possible by prior arrangement. The mill stands out for its historical architecture and preserved ancient elements in its surroundings, telling stories of its past activity.
